Create a template definition or framework for Admin GUI

Description

Templates should include Admin GUI look and feel, navigation objects, header and footer, representation for lists, tables and other views for any content

CC: Add a template file which has header/footer/and navigation bar compositions. The template file should include the global JS/CSS references. Update current pages to follow this paradigm (create user, remote gateways (dashboard)).

QA: ensure that navigation and existing functionality is not broken.

Resolution Details

Created Template layout for the Admingui using JSF Templates feature and updated the existing pages with base template. PR for this code change:
https://github.com/CONNECT-Solution/CONNECT/pull/778. Modified few Jquery script for sidebarpane template. https://github.com/CONNECT-Solution/CONNECT/pull/785

Activity

Show:

Srinivas Murthy May 15, 2014 at 8:27 PM

1. Built and deployed new code.
2. Checked Dashboard, remote gateway list and performance statistics from side pane, and tab headings.
3. Executed validation check and verified the remote gateway list entries.
4. Created a new user
5. Logged in with the new user id and checked the Dashboard, remote gateway list and performance statistics tabs.

Srinivas Murthy May 13, 2014 at 1:29 PM

Taken for QA

Fixed

Details

Assignee

Reporter

LOE

Unknown

Story Points

Time tracking

1d logged

Sprint

Fix versions

Priority

Created April 30, 2014 at 7:25 PM
Updated May 15, 2014 at 8:27 PM
Resolved May 15, 2014 at 3:41 PM